titleOfInvention |
Process for industrial separation of by-product alcohols |
abstract |
It is an object of the present invention to provide a specific industrial separation process that enables a by-produced alcohol to be separated out efficiently and stably for a prolonged period of time from a large amount (not less than 1 ton /hr) of a low boiling point reaction mixture having a specified composition containing the by-produced alcohol when mass-producing aromatic carbonates on an industrial scale by subjecting a dialkyl carbonate and an aromatic monohydroxy compound to transesterification reaction in a reactive distillation column in which a catalyst is present. Although there have been various proposals regarding processes for the production of aromatic carbonates by means of a reactive distillation method, these have all been on a small scale and short operating time laboratory level, and there have been no disclosures whatsoever on a specific process or apparatus enabling mass production on an industrial scale to be carried out stably for a prolonged period of time. Moreover, there have been no disclosures on a specific process or apparatus enabling the alcohol by-produced when producing the aromatic carbonates on an industrial scale using a reactive distillation system to be separated out efficiently and stably for a prolonged period of time on an industrial scale of not less than 200 kg / hr. According to the present invention, there is proposed a specific process that enables the above object to be attained by using the continuous multi-stage distillation column having a specified structure and a large amount (not less than 1 ton / hr) of a low boiling point reaction mixture having a specified composition containing the by-produced alcohol. |
